action_liu

    1. PGA112中的Ra怎么选? 2/3954 模拟与混合信号 2012-02-11
      Bryan,您好! 很高兴收到您的回复,我觉得我理解了您的思路了。 下一个版本再4-8周内应该有结果,到时我再把结果贴上来。 至于串扰的问题,我想先照你的思路做,我也会在Ra1与Vref之间加一个跳线,如果串扰太厉害就断开。 昨天在写中文帖子的时候,也有写了一个英语的帖子,也有人用英语回答了问题,我觉得英语回答的思路也是一种解决方法,供您参考。 再次感谢并周末愉快! 刘 Taizhong, Figure 77 in the PGA112 datasheet shows two different approaches to scale a bipolar input signal to a useable voltage range for the PGA112, Vin0 is AC-coupled through the capacitor while Vin1 is DC-coupled. In the AC coupled application (Vin0) the capacitor and the resistor RA form a high-pass filter with a corner frequency at 1/ (2*pi*R*C) therefore the value of RA is determined by the necessary low-frequency response and the value of the input capacitor. As you noticed in the figure, there is no DC voltage drop across resistor RA, this is because the input impedance of the PGA112 is very high (10 Gigaohms typ) and so very little current flows through this resistor, producing negligible voltage drop. This DOES NOT mean that RA is 0 ohm, in fact making RA a small resistance will create a very high corner frequency as shown in the previous equation. As for your second question, the amount of disturbance between the two channels depends on the output impedance of your voltage reference (should be very low) as well as the common-mode rejection ratio of the input amplifier (usually very high). Because a good DC voltage reference will have a very low output impedance I would not expect much disturbance between the channels however, as frequency increases inter-channel crosstalk will increase. John Caldwell Analog Applications Engineer PA Linear Apps
    2. 28027程序固化和flash api error #1 11/9397 微控制器 MCU 2012-02-10
      刚才看到版主要求问题解决了给大家一个回复。这个确实我不应该,没有做到。 这个问题最后在8月底解决了。 解决的过程是这样的,可能是和api的版本有关,也应该和芯片的reset有关。 我用的CCS3.3, 第一步应该是用了最新的api。这要感谢囧神,也要感谢TI的技术支持工程师,有些TI的技术支持工程师是非常负责的,他们对业务也比较熟悉,因此,有问题问TI的技术支持工程师也是很好的选择。 api的解决是个基础。 后来发现还是不行,我只好乱试,最终发现给芯片断电,供电就好,程序就可以跑了。 11月份的时候,没有用网上的开发板,自己做的板子,也是采用断电的方式,程序也能跑,反而用CCS的chip reset不行。道理我没有搞懂,但既然问题解决了,我本身也是初学者,现在在学pga112,因此,也没有去搞明白究竟是怎么回事。 谢谢!
    3. 28027程序固化和flash api error #1 11/9397 微控制器 MCU 2011-08-03
      多谢安然指教! 程序只有一个cmd. (就是ti例程里面的f28027.cmd,我只是把praml0,draml0的起始地点改了,长度也改了;修改以上两项的目的是我的程序超过了ti例程里面设定的praml0的长度,它原始的长度是900*16) 我目前碰到的问题是写进flash的时候就出来s/w breakpoint. 另外,我有些不明白,如果写入flash后需要把程序搬回RAM里运行,哪该怎么弄呢?还有,28027的flash是32k*16,可是RAM只有4k*16,这样的话,flash的空间还能充分利用吗?
    4. 28027程序固化和flash api error #1 11/9397 微控制器 MCU 2011-08-03
      抱歉,是我帖子写错了。 周立功上面讲“程序固化的那个章节”的时候,要求: 移除28027_RAM_link.cmd,添加28027.cmd.我于是就按照周立功的手册做了。问题现在还没有解决,版主有什么建议没有?包括是否有些书或者资料可以介绍? 版主说“怎么也应该对应用的是flash的吧”是什么意思?
    5. 28027软中断问题 7/5693 微控制器 MCU 2011-07-31
      rs232是放在主程序里的,没有放在中断里。(实际上本人的程序里面没有用到中断,用的是中断标志位,用查询的方式来做的。) 因为程序能跑了,全局变量初始化也就没有试,估计会冒顶。程序已经到了 a32,数据再有700,基本就溢出了。然后最近还比较忙,因此,没有试全局变量初始化的问题。 本人今天试着把程序写进flash中时,又出现问题。一会儿单独写写。
    6. 28027软中断问题 7/5693 微控制器 MCU 2011-07-28
      各位朋友,刚才看到一个帖子,是Vimman's Sky http://vimman.21ic.org/ 写的,大意是程序空间和数据空间重叠了,引起非法isr。我赶紧看了我的程序,也是程序空间与数据空间重叠,于是我修改28027ram_link里面的Draml0的起始位置,问题就解决了。大家共享!

最近访客

< 1/1 >

统计信息

已有98人来访过

  • 芯积分:--
  • 好友:--
  • 主题:3
  • 回复:6

留言

你需要登录后才可以留言 登录 | 注册


现在还没有留言